type CloudRedisClusterClient

type CloudRedisClusterClient interface {
	// Lists all Redis clusters owned by a project in either the specified
	// location (region) or all locations.
	//
	// The location should have the following format:
	//
	// * `projects/{project_id}/locations/{location_id}`
	//
	// If `location_id` is specified as `-` (wildcard), then all regions
	// available to the project are queried, and the results are aggregated.
	ListClusters(ctx context.Context, in *ListClustersRequest, opts ...grpc.CallOption) (*ListClustersResponse, error)
	// Gets the details of a specific Redis cluster.
	GetCluster(ctx context.Context, in *GetClusterRequest, opts ...grpc.CallOption) (*Cluster, error)
	// Updates the metadata and configuration of a specific Redis cluster.
	//
	// Completed longrunning.Operation will contain the new cluster object
	// in the response field. The returned operation is automatically deleted
	// after a few hours, so there is no need to call DeleteOperation.
	UpdateCluster(ctx context.Context, in *UpdateClusterRequest, opts ...grpc.CallOption) (*longrunningpb.Operation, error)
	// Deletes a specific Redis cluster. Cluster stops serving and data is
	// deleted.
	DeleteCluster(ctx context.Context, in *DeleteClusterRequest, opts ...grpc.CallOption) (*longrunningpb.Operation, error)
	// Creates a Redis cluster based on the specified properties.
	// The creation is executed asynchronously and callers may check the returned
	// operation to track its progress. Once the operation is completed the Redis
	// cluster will be fully functional. The completed longrunning.Operation will
	// contain the new cluster object in the response field.
	//
	// The returned operation is automatically deleted after a few hours, so there
	// is no need to call DeleteOperation.
	CreateCluster(ctx context.Context, in *CreateClusterRequest, opts ...grpc.CallOption) (*longrunningpb.Operation, error)
	// Gets the details of certificate authority information for Redis cluster.
	GetClusterCertificateAuthority(ctx context.Context, in *GetClusterCertificateAuthorityRequest, opts ...grpc.CallOption) (*CertificateAuthority, error)
}

CloudRedisClusterClient is the client API for CloudRedisCluster service.

For semantics around ctx use and closing/ending streaming RPCs, please refer to https://pkg.go.dev/google.golang.org/grpc/?tab=doc#ClientConn.NewStream.

type Cluster

type Cluster struct {

	// Required. Unique name of the resource in this scope including project and
	// location using the form:
	//
	//	`projects/{project_id}/locations/{location_id}/clusters/{cluster_id}`
	Name string `protobuf:"bytes,1,opt,name=name,proto3" json:"name,omitempty"`
	// Output only. The timestamp associated with the cluster creation request.
	CreateTime *timestamp.Timestamp `protobuf:"bytes,3,opt,name=create_time,json=createTime,proto3" json:"create_time,omitempty"`
	// Output only. The current state of this cluster.
	// Can be CREATING, READY, UPDATING, DELETING and SUSPENDED
	State Cluster_State `protobuf:"varint,4,opt,name=state,proto3,enum=mockgcp.cloud.redis.cluster.v1.Cluster_State" json:"state,omitempty"`
	// Output only. System assigned, unique identifier for the cluster.
	Uid string `protobuf:"bytes,5,opt,name=uid,proto3" json:"uid,omitempty"`
	// Optional. The number of replica nodes per shard.
	ReplicaCount *int32 `protobuf:"varint,8,opt,name=replica_count,json=replicaCount,proto3,oneof" json:"replica_count,omitempty"`
	// Optional. The authorization mode of the Redis cluster.
	// If not provided, auth feature is disabled for the cluster.
	AuthorizationMode AuthorizationMode `` /* 168-byte string literal not displayed */
	// Optional. The in-transit encryption for the Redis cluster.
	// If not provided, encryption  is disabled for the cluster.
	TransitEncryptionMode TransitEncryptionMode `` /* 186-byte string literal not displayed */
	// Output only. Redis memory size in GB for the entire cluster rounded up to
	// the next integer.
	SizeGb *int32 `protobuf:"varint,13,opt,name=size_gb,json=sizeGb,proto3,oneof" json:"size_gb,omitempty"`
	// Required. Number of shards for the Redis cluster.
	ShardCount *int32 `protobuf:"varint,14,opt,name=shard_count,json=shardCount,proto3,oneof" json:"shard_count,omitempty"`
	// Required. Each PscConfig configures the consumer network where IPs will
	// be designated to the cluster for client access through Private Service
	// Connect Automation. Currently, only one PscConfig is supported.
	PscConfigs []*PscConfig `protobuf:"bytes,15,rep,name=psc_configs,json=pscConfigs,proto3" json:"psc_configs,omitempty"`
	// Output only. Endpoints created on each given network, for Redis clients to
	// connect to the cluster. Currently only one discovery endpoint is supported.
	DiscoveryEndpoints []*DiscoveryEndpoint `protobuf:"bytes,16,rep,name=discovery_endpoints,json=discoveryEndpoints,proto3" json:"discovery_endpoints,omitempty"`
	// Output only. PSC connections for discovery of the cluster topology and
	// accessing the cluster.
	PscConnections []*PscConnection `protobuf:"bytes,17,rep,name=psc_connections,json=pscConnections,proto3" json:"psc_connections,omitempty"`
	// Output only. Additional information about the current state of the cluster.
	StateInfo *Cluster_StateInfo `protobuf:"bytes,18,opt,name=state_info,json=stateInfo,proto3" json:"state_info,omitempty"`
	// Optional. The type of a redis node in the cluster. NodeType determines the
	// underlying machine-type of a redis node.
	NodeType NodeType `` /* 132-byte string literal not displayed */
	// Optional. Persistence config (RDB, AOF) for the cluster.
	PersistenceConfig *ClusterPersistenceConfig `protobuf:"bytes,20,opt,name=persistence_config,json=persistenceConfig,proto3" json:"persistence_config,omitempty"`
	// Optional. Key/Value pairs of customer overrides for mutable Redis Configs
	RedisConfigs map[string]string `` /* 186-byte string literal not displayed */
	// Output only. Precise value of redis memory size in GB for the entire
	// cluster.
	PreciseSizeGb *float64 `protobuf:"fixed64,22,opt,name=precise_size_gb,json=preciseSizeGb,proto3,oneof" json:"precise_size_gb,omitempty"`
	// Optional. This config will be used to determine how the customer wants us
	// to distribute cluster resources within the region.
	ZoneDistributionConfig *ZoneDistributionConfig `` /* 130-byte string literal not displayed */
	// Optional. The delete operation will fail when the value is set to true.
	DeletionProtectionEnabled *bool `` /* 146-byte string literal not displayed */
	// contains filtered or unexported fields
}

A cluster instance.

type ClusterPersistenceConfig_AOFConfig_AppendFsync

type ClusterPersistenceConfig_AOFConfig_AppendFsync int32

Available fsync modes.

const (
	// Not set. Default: EVERYSEC
	ClusterPersistenceConfig_AOFConfig_APPEND_FSYNC_UNSPECIFIED ClusterPersistenceConfig_AOFConfig_AppendFsync = 0
	// Never fsync. Normally Linux will flush data every 30 seconds with this
	// configuration, but it's up to the kernel's exact tuning.
	ClusterPersistenceConfig_AOFConfig_NO ClusterPersistenceConfig_AOFConfig_AppendFsync = 1
	// fsync every second. Fast enough, and you may lose 1 second of data if
	// there is a disaster
	ClusterPersistenceConfig_AOFConfig_EVERYSEC ClusterPersistenceConfig_AOFConfig_AppendFsync = 2
	// fsync every time new commands are appended to the AOF. It has the best
	// data loss protection at the cost of performance
	ClusterPersistenceConfig_AOFConfig_ALWAYS ClusterPersistenceConfig_AOFConfig_AppendFsync = 3
)

type ListClustersResponse

type ListClustersResponse struct {

	// A list of Redis clusters in the project in the specified location,
	// or across all locations.
	//
	// If the `location_id` in the parent field of the request is "-", all regions
	// available to the project are queried, and the results aggregated.
	// If in such an aggregated query a location is unavailable, a placeholder
	// Redis entry is included in the response with the `name` field set to a
	// value of the form
	// `projects/{project_id}/locations/{location_id}/clusters/`- and the
	// `status` field set to ERROR and `status_message` field set to "location not
	// available for ListClusters".
	Clusters []*Cluster `protobuf:"bytes,1,rep,name=clusters,proto3" json:"clusters,omitempty"`
	// Token to retrieve the next page of results, or empty if there are no more
	// results in the list.
	NextPageToken string `protobuf:"bytes,2,opt,name=next_page_token,json=nextPageToken,proto3" json:"next_page_token,omitempty"`
	// Locations that could not be reached.
	Unreachable []string `protobuf:"bytes,3,rep,name=unreachable,proto3" json:"unreachable,omitempty"`
	// contains filtered or unexported fields
}

Response for [ListClusters][CloudRedis.ListClusters].
